Types of Camera White Lens

Camera white lenses come in various types, each designed for specific situations and photography styles. Here are some popular options:

  • Telephoto Lenses: Ideal for wildlife or sports photography, these lenses offer a long focal length to capture subjects from a distance.
  • Wide-Angle Lenses: Perfect for landscape or architecture photography, they provide a broader field of view to capture expansive scenes.
  • Macro Lenses: Designed for extreme close-ups, these lenses allow you to capture intricate details of small subjects, such as flowers or insects.
  • Standard Zoom Lenses: These versatile lenses cover a range of focal lengths, making them suitable for various photography situations, from portraits to events.

Features and Function of Camera White Lenses

Understanding the features of a camera white lens can assist photographers in making informed decisions. Some key attributes include:

  • Optical Coatings: High-quality white lenses often come with advanced coatings to reduce glare and increase light transmission, ensuring that your images remain sharp and vibrant.
  • Built-in Image Stabilization: This feature helps to reduce motion blur, especially in low-light conditions or when shooting at longer focal lengths.
  • Weather Sealing: Many white lenses are designed with weather-resistant features, allowing photographers to shoot in a variety of environments without fear of damage.
  • Fast Autofocus: Top-of-the-line white lenses provide quick and accurate autofocus capabilities, enabling you to capture fast-moving subjects with ease.

Benefits of Using Camera White Lenses

Integrating a camera white lens into your photography kit comes with numerous advantages, including:

  • Enhanced Image Quality: The premium optics of white lenses result in high-definition images with excellent color reproduction and detail.
  • Stylish Aesthetic: The striking appearance of a white lens not only makes your camera look modern but can also serve as a talking point among fellow photographers.
  • Durability: Many white lenses are built to withstand the rigors of photography, offering longevity and reliability over time.
  • Improved Performance in Bright Light: White lenses are less prone to overheating when exposed to direct sunlight, offering consistent performance in bright conditions.
